Top Georgia Schools in Radio, TV & Digital Communication

Our 2023 rankings named Georgia Institute of Technology - Main Campus the best school in Georgia for radio, television and digital communication students. Georgia Tech is a very large public school located in the large city of Atlanta.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Savannah College of Art and Design. It ranked #2 on our 2023 Best Radio, TV & Digital Communication Schools in Georgia list. Located in the city of Savannah, SCAD is a private not-for-profit school with a large student population.

The excellent programs at Kennesaw State University helped the school earn the #3 place on this year’s ranking of the best radio, television and digital communication schools in Georgia. Located in the suburb of Kennesaw, KSU Georgia is a public school with a fairly large student population.
